What is Potassium Chloride, Sodium Chloride, Calcium Chloride Dihydrate, Glucose, Sodium Lactate?
Hartmann + Glucose Viaflo is an intravenous solution containing potassium chloride, sodium chloride, calcium chloride dihydrate, glucose, and sodium lactate. The product’s strength is not specified, and it is supplied as a sterile liquid for infusion. Designed for fluid and electrolyte replacement, the formulation provides essential ions and glucose to support extracellular volume and metabolic needs during treatment in hospital and recovery.
What is Potassium Chloride, Sodium Chloride, Calcium Chloride Dihydrate, Glucose, Sodium Lactate used for?
Hartmann + Glucose Viaflo is indicated for clinical situations that require rapid restoration of intravascular volume and electrolyte balance.
- Fluid replacement in patients with hypovolemia or dehydration. - Electrolyte replenishment after significant fluid loss (e.g., burns, diarrhea, vomiting). - Support of postoperative patients to maintain circulating volume. - Management of patients receiving parenteral nutrition who need additional glucose and electrolytes. - Treatment of metabolic acidosis when combined with appropriate clinical measures.
What are the side effects of Potassium Chloride, Sodium Chloride, Calcium Chloride Dihydrate, Glucose, Sodium Lactate?
Adverse reactions to Hartmann + Glucose Viaflo are generally infrequent, but they can occur with any intravenous therapy.
Common: - Mild local irritation at the infusion site. - Transient nausea or vomiting. - Slight increase in serum potassium or sodium levels. - Temporary hyperglycemia in susceptible individuals.
Serious: - Severe electrolyte imbalance (hyperkalemia, hypernatremia) leading to cardiac arrhythmia. - Anaphylactic or severe allergic reaction. - Fluid overload causing pulmonary edema.
What precautions apply to Potassium Chloride, Sodium Chloride, Calcium Chloride Dihydrate, Glucose, Sodium Lactate?
Clinicians should evaluate patient-specific factors before administering Hartmann + Glucose Viaflo to minimize risks.
- Assess baseline electrolyte and glucose levels; adjust infusion rate accordingly. - Use caution in patients with renal or cardiac impairment due to risk of fluid overload. - Avoid rapid infusion in neonates or patients with compromised vascular integrity. - Monitor for signs of hyperkalemia, especially in those receiving potassium‑sparing medications. - Do not administer to patients with known hypersensitivity to any component of the solution. - Consider alternative fluids for patients with severe metabolic acidosis not corrected by lactate.
What does Potassium Chloride, Sodium Chloride, Calcium Chloride Dihydrate, Glucose, Sodium Lactate interact with?
Hartmann + Glucose Viaflo may interact with other medications that affect electrolyte balance, glucose metabolism, or fluid status.
Avoid: - Concurrent high‑dose potassium supplements or potassium‑sparing diuretics, which can precipitate hyperkalemia. - Large volumes of other sodium‑rich IV fluids that may cause hypernatremia. - Intravenous insulin administered without glucose monitoring, increasing risk of hypoglycemia.
Use with caution: - Loop or thiazide diuretics, requiring close monitoring of electrolyte shifts. - Calcium channel blockers, as rapid changes in calcium levels may affect cardiac conduction. - Blood transfusions, because combined fluid loads can lead to volume overload. - Medications that alter lactate metabolism, such as metformin, necessitating careful acid‑base assessment.
